Do car salesmen get commission on leases?

Most salesman will get 25 to 30 percent of the profit with a minimum vommission for low profit deals being between $100 and $300. The commission percentage will vary slightly. I made most of my money on leases because most people don’t know what the sales price is .

Why do car salesmen want you to lease?

Lease deals are easier to sell But in more words, leasing is attractive to the dealer even more so than the customer because lease deals are much easier to sell. When you lease a car, you’re not paying for the total price of the car like you do when financing.

How do car leasing agents make money?

Car Finance Companies Make Money with Leasing Just like a bank, they make money by charging customers a monthly finance fee. In the case of a lease, it’s called money factor, which is similar to APR (annual percentage rate) interest on a loan.

What kind of Commission does a car salesman get?

The commission on new car sales varies based on the car brand, car dealership and location but the usual commission for a car salesman is between 20-to-30 percent of the profit. The profit amount also varies from one dealership to another.

What kind of pay plan does a car salesman have?

There are two major pay plans in the retail car sales world, commission only and fixed/set salary. The professional car salesman on a commission only pay plan would not have it any other way. They understand depending on how hard and smart they work towards selling cars is a direct reflection on how much commission they will earn.

What happens if a car salesman does not sell enough cars?

If a car salesman does not sell enough cars in a month on a commission only sales plan to meet the states guidelines on minimum wage. The dealer will give the salesperson a “draw” against their commission. This option will not last very long either, commonly just a few months.
